Can school staff discuss student records in public areas?

Explanation:
Under FERPA (Family Educational Rights and Privacy Act), the protection of student records is paramount, and unauthorized disclosure of personally identifiable information is prohibited. This means that any discussion of student records in public areas, where unintended parties may overhear, is not allowed. Such discussions could lead to breaches of confidentiality, violating students' rights to privacy as outlined in FERPA. FERPA specifically restricts the sharing of identifiable information without appropriate consent from the student or their parents, which reinforces the importance of maintaining confidentiality. Therefore, regardless of the context, discussing student records in public spaces contradicts the principles of privacy established by FERPA. The legislation is designed to protect student information from being disclosed indiscriminately, ensuring that personal data remains secure and within the appropriate educational contexts.
